Transaction 31a811170e08d925dcd9f680ebb443930d5e7e75c552b611c924c8f18d8cc82e
1 Input
2 Outputs
- 31a811170e08d925dcd9f680ebb443930d5e7e75c552b611c924c8f18d8cc82e:0
- 31a811170e08d925dcd9f680ebb443930d5e7e75c552b611c924c8f18d8cc82e:1
value 100227
address 1FsuPrfek76VDwub9G2hXLamBPPsQTNARY
value 3344479046
address 3AbixYB8q3hHuAkFWSxUnTtqncFgRFYGDb